Compare Columbia College and College of Marin

Both Columbia College and College of Marin are Public, 2-4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Columbia College and College of Marin with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are public.
  • C of Marin's tuition ($9,864) is more expensive than CC ($8,870).
  • C of Marin's students to faculty ratio (16 to 1) is lower than CC (20 to 1).
  • C of Marin (4,673 students) is larger than CC (2,594 students) with more enrolled students.
  • C of Marin ($4,400) has higher amount of financial aid than CC ($1,840).
  • C of Marin's graduation rate (36%) is higher than CC (30%).
